Newton Kansan - PUBLISHED: Wednesday, November 29, 2006 and Hutch News - 11-30-2006:
MOUNDRIDGE — Lillie M. Boesker, 89, of Moundridge died Tuesday (Nov. 28, 2006) at Memorial Home in Moundridge.
She was born April 7, 1917, in McPherson County to Walter J. and Anna (Buehler) Hoyer.
She was a lifetime area resident and had been a homemaker. She was a member of St. John's Lutheran Church in Moundridge.
On April 12, 1942, she married Albert "Buck" Boesker in Canton. He died on Jan. 27, 1996.
Survivors include: sons, Roland Boesker of Burns and Dwight Boesker of Peabody; daughters, Ruth Boesker and Ruby Jantzen, both of Moundridge; sister, Helen Rice of Greenleaf; two grandchildren; and five great-grandchildren.
She was preceded in death by a daughter, Yvonne Boesker; brother, Norman Hoyer; foster brother, Carlton Johnson; and foster sisters, Martha Vogts and Florence Rahe.
A family committal service has taken place. Burial was in Spring Valley Cemetery of Meridian Township in rural Moundridge.
